We compared the server Intel Xeon E5 2643 v3 with 6 cores 3.4GHz and the laptop Intel Core i7 1165G7 with 4 cores 1.2G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

Intel Xeon E5 2643 v3 's Advantages
Higher base frequency (3.4GHz vs 2.8GHz)
Larger L3 cache size (20MB vs 12MB)
Intel Core i7 1165G7 's Advantages
Released 6 years late
Integrated graphics card
Higher specification of memory (4267 vs 2133)
Newer PCIe version (4.0 vs 3)
More modern manufacturing process (10nm vs 22nm)
Lower TDP (28W vs 135W)
